Interventionist versus expectant care for severe pre-eclampsia between 24 and 34 weeks' gestation.

CONCLUSIONS: This review suggested that an expectant approach to the management of women with severe early onset pre-eclampsia may be associated with decreased morbidity for the baby. However, this evidence was based on data from only six trials. Further large, high-quality trials are needed to confirm or refute these findings, and establish if this approach is safe for the mother. PMID: 30289565 [PubMed - as supplied by publisher]
